navicat 分配用户
时间: 2023-09-06 19:02:25 浏览: 43
Navicat是一款功能强大的数据库管理工具,在使用Navicat时,我们可以通过分配用户来控制数据库的访问权限。分配用户可以帮助我们实现安全的数据库管理。
首先,我们可以通过Navicat创建新用户。打开Navicat软件后,选择目标数据库,然后在工具栏上点击“用户”按钮,再选择“创建用户”。在创建用户界面,我们可以设置用户的用户名和密码,并确定该用户的身份。
接下来,我们可以为新用户分配权限。在Navicat中,我们可以精确地控制一个用户对数据库的操作权限,如读取、写入、删除等。我们可以通过点击“权限”选项卡来进行设置。在权限选项卡中,我们可以为不同的数据库对象(如表格、视图、过程等)分配具体的权限。
此外,我们还可以为用户分配特定的主机,限制其访问数据库的范围。在Navicat中,我们可以在“常规”选项卡中选择“允许登录IP地址段”来设定特定的IP地址,只有来自这些IP地址的请求才能被该用户处理。
当我们完成用户的分配后,用户就可以使用所分配的用户名和密码来登录Navicat,并进行数据库操作。用户可以根据所分配的权限对数据库进行数据的读取、插入、更新和删除等操作。
在数据库管理中,合理地分配用户是非常重要的,它能够确保数据库的安全性,并提高数据库的管理效率。Navicat作为便捷的数据库管理工具,提供了简洁明了的用户分配功能,为数据库管理员提供了更好的管理工具。
相关问题
navicat授权用户权限不生效
navicat是一款广泛使用的数据库管理工具,用于连接和管理各种数据库。导致navicat授权用户权限不生效的问题可能有以下几种情况。
首先,可能是由于数据库本身的权限设置问题导致的。在navicat中,我们可以创建用户并为其分配相应的权限,但这些权限还需要在数据库服务器端进行配置才能生效。如果数据库服务器端的权限限制了navicat用户所属的用户的权限,那么在使用navicat时就会出现权限不生效的情况。
其次,还可能是由于数据库服务器端的网络访问限制导致的。navicat连接数据库时需要通过网络进行通信,如果数据库服务器端对网络访问进行了限制,比如仅允许特定IP地址或端口访问,那么导致navicat无法连接或权限不生效的问题。
此外,还有可能是navicat本身的设置问题。navicat提供了一些配置选项,比如可以选择连接数据库时使用的用户、密码等,如果这些选项设置不正确,就会导致授权用户权限不生效。
解决这些问题的方法如下:首先,可以检查数据库服务器端的权限设置,并确保允许navicat用户具有所需的权限。其次,确认数据库服务器端对网络访问没有限制。最后,确保navicat连接数据库时的配置选项设置正确。
综上所述,导致navicat授权用户权限不生效的原因可能有多重,需要仔细检查和调整数据库服务器端和navicat本身的相关设置才能解决该问题。
navicat premium Oracle创建用户
要在Navicat Premium中创建Oracle用户,请按照以下步骤操作:
1. 在连接到Oracle数据库的Navicat窗口中,右键单击要创建用户的模式(例如SYS)并选择“新建用户”。
2. 在“新建用户”窗口中,输入要创建的用户名和密码,并选择要将其分配给的表空间。
3. 在“系统权限”选项卡中,选择要授予该用户的系统权限。
4. 在“对象权限”选项卡中,选择要授予该用户的对象权限。
5. 单击“确定”以创建用户。
注意:创建用户需要具有CREATE USER系统权限的用户。如果当前登录用户没有此权限,则需要先授予该权限。